This document outlines the West Clermont Local Schools' Student Wellness and Success Funding Plan, which reinforces the district's commitment to the behavioral and mental health and wellness of all students. The plan details the implementation of Multi-Tiered Systems of Support (MTSS) aimed at addressing identified needs through foundational, universal (Tier 1), targeted (Tier 2), and intensive (Tier 3) supports. It emphasizes the vital role of School Counselors in providing consultative and direct services, in collaboration with a wide array of internal and external community providers, to eliminate barriers to student access, participation, and growth in learning.

The Greater Cincinnati Business Advisory Council's 2025-2026 Joint Statement outlines the council's fulfillment of statutory responsibilities and progress towards its goals. The document highlights five key strategic areas: expanding career-based learning opportunities, strengthening employer engagement, supporting the career connector network, developing workforce-aligned academic innovation, and increasing equity and access for students. These efforts collectively aim to prepare students for high-demand, high-skill, and high-wage careers and to strengthen regional workforce alignment.
